Matthieu Mazué 'Turn of Events' feat. Francisco Mela and Diego Hedez
A new project initiated in New York City by pianist Matthieu Mazué, “Turn of Events” brings together three musicians with strong and distinct musical visions, each widely recognized for their exceptional improvisational talents. Alongside Mazué is drummer Francisco Mela, a major figure on the contemporary jazz scene who has performed with McCoy Tyner and Kenny Barron, and trumpeter Diego Hedez, a regular collaborator of bassist William Parker.
Together, they explore new sonic territories within a deliberately bassless formation — an artistic choice that frees the piano from its traditionally codified harmonic role. This absence opens the way to a more transparent sound and a lighter, freer approach to the instrument. The dialogue between piano and drums becomes a central pillar — not only supporting the trumpet but also redefining the piano’s traditional role as accompanist. The drums, in turn, unfold with remarkable rhythmic freedom, shaping the contours of improvisation with flexibility and inventiveness.
